Canadian Solar Inc. has appointed Guangchun Zhang chief operating officer (COO). In this role, he will oversee all aspects of the company's production operations, including manufacturing, quality control, research and development, as well as environmental and safety management.

Zhang has more than 18 years of experience in the photovoltaic industry. Before joining Canadian Solar, he worked for Suntech Power Holdings Co. Ltd., most recently as vice president for research and development and industrialization of manufacturing technology.

Prior to joining Suntech, he worked at the Centre for Photovoltaic Engineering at the University of New South Wales in Australia and Pacific Solar Pty. Ltd.
